Journalist Salary in Cheyenne, Wyoming
The median journalist salary in Cheyenne, WY is $52,602 per year, which is 6% below the national median and 2.2% above the Wyoming state average.

Journalist Salary in Cheyenne by Experience
In Cheyenne, an entry-level journalist earns around $32,900, while experienced professionals earn up to $94,000 per year. The local cost of living index is 94% of the national average.

Salary Percentiles in Cheyenne, WY
| Percentile | Cheyenne |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ile | $30,080 |
| 25th Percentile | $37,600 |
| Median (50th) | $52,602 |
| 75th Percentile | $73,320 |
| 90th Percentile | $103,400 |

Job Outlook
Nationally, journalist employment is projected to grow -3% over the next decade (decline). Demand in Cheyenne may vary based on local industry and population growth.
